# Basement Archive Room — Night Access

The archive room under Pellworth House holds old contracts and the tape backups. Night shift: take stairwell C, not the lift (it's switched off after midnight). Lights are on a timer by the door — slap the button as you go in. Sign the logbook, even at 3am, yes really. The keypad by the door takes the code below.

staff pass of fahap-tajeg = bdg-FT-6

**Alert: TileForge cache hit ratio below threshold**

Heads up — the Lantermere tile-rendering cache layer is serving way more misses than usual, which means the raster workers are re-rendering tiles that should be warm. Usually this is either a bad deploy flushing the cache or the eviction knob getting bumped. Check recent config changes first, then worker logs. If it's genuinely hot traffic, scale the cache pool. The runbook with exact steps is posted at the following page.

wiki page, bagaf-fawip: https://harbor.tolvaqsys.local/pages/repo/pages/secrets/eac969ffc71f356b

## Build Provenance — SplitGate Assignment Service

SplitGate assigns A/B experiment buckets at the edge. All builds run on the hermetic Farrow pipeline; no developer machines can publish artifacts. Assignment logic is pinned to a signed config snapshot per release. Verify the attestation chain before approving rollout. The token for the current production build appears below.

trace token, tawep-fahif: htk3_b58

## v4.2.0 — Changed defaults

Grelline API: fixed the N+1 query storm on nested GraphQL resolvers by enabling the batch loader by default. Per-request query caps and loader batch sizes changed accordingly. New hires: don't override these locally unless profiling says otherwise. The new default configuration shipped with this release is listed below.

deployment values, yadug-bawif:
[framir]
team = pelox
access_code = ac_a38ab2
owner = tamion.julael
host = framir.tolvaqlabs.test
port = 11211
peer = tammir.zemvargrid.local
salt = 2215ef03
pin = 1541